Voted ‘Australia’s Best Major Tourism Attraction’ at the QANTAS Australian Tourism Awards, and best Victorian Major Tourist Attraction for three years in a row, the heritage-listed Royal Botanic Gardens Melbourne and the contemporary native Australian Royal Botanic Gardens Cranbourne, offer a plethora of unique outdoor experiences.

From a punt ride on the lake, or a relaxing picnic under the oaks, to a guided cultural walk or explorer bus ride along the many meandering trails, there’s always something new to enjoy.

Royal Botanic Gardens Melbourne is widely admired as a living work of art and one of the world’s most beautiful botanic gardens.  Within the Gardens are specially curated Living Collections.  Our Living Collections are made up of accurately identified, documented and labelled plants for conservation, display, education, interpretation and research.  Some Collections are in a specific location in the Gardens, for example the New Zealand Collection or the Australian Forest Walk, others are distributed throughout the gorgeous plantings in garden beds, or as signature specimens in lawns.
